Bluetooth: close HCI device when user channel socket gets closed
With 9380f9eacfbbee701daa416edd6625efcd3e29e1 the order of unsetting the HCI_USER_CHANNEL flag of the HCI device was reverted to ensure the device is first closed before making it available again. Due to hci_dev_close checking for HCI_USER_CHANNEL being set on the device it was never really closed and was kept opened. We're now calling hci_dev_do_close directly to make sure the device is correctly closed and we keep the correct order to unset the flag on our device object.
